Polyethylene glycol monooleate Uses

1、Polyethylene glycol monooleate(9004-96-0) is used as an emulsifier for personal care and water treatment and as a 、processing aid in textile industry.

3、Polyethylene glycol monooleate(9004-96-0) is a mid-range HLB, surface active agent suggested for use in animal feed (emulsifier), cosmetics (emulsifier), textile chemicals (emulsifier, lubricant, softener, scouring agent), coatings (emulsifier) and industrial degreasers.

Polyethylene glycol monooleate Safety Profile

Moderately toxic by intravenous routes. An eye irritant. When heated to decomposition POLYGLYCOL OLEATE emits acrid smoke and irritating fumes.
